Plastic Reconstructive and Aesthetic Surgery Study Program Hosts Visiting Professor Lecture from Hong Kong

The Specialist Study Program in Reconstructive and Aesthetic Plastic Surgery at the Faculty of Medicine, Udayana University, is pleased to invite Professor Cecilia Li-Tsang Wai Ping, PhD, M.Phil, P.D.O.T., H.K.R.O.T., O.T(C), from the Faculty of Health & Social Sciences at The Hong Kong Polytechnic University, to deliver a lecture and discussion on Burn Rehabilitation in Children on March 3, 2023.

The purpose of this event is to provide students and faculty members with new experiences and insights, as well as to enhance the quality of education and services in the field of plastic surgery.

Through this program, students and faculty members will have the opportunity to gain new knowledge and experiences from renowned experts and practitioners in the field of burn care from abroad. It is hoped that this will better prepare students and faculty members to face the challenges in burn care for children. The Visiting Professor program also opens up opportunities for collaboration between universities in different countries and provides students with the chance to participate in student exchange programs or research abroad.
